The way that I know how to do this, is the following:
1.  press e for the keymail program.
2.  press w to send an e-mail.
3. press enter until you get to subject and type your subject line.
4.  press enter and it will say attach an attachment say yes.
5. it will ask you for the attachment, press backspace for the current folder, press backspace again for the drive.
6.  type the appropriate drive, and press enter.
7.  find the folder you want and press enter.
8. press space with x until it says all files and press space with dots 3-5 and press enter. 9. if they are in a braille format, it will ask you if you want to send them in another format, press enter and the default is microsoft word.
You should be good to go.
